    HUNTER-SE is the Ackermann front steering drive-by-wire chassis designed for the challenging conditions and speed requirements of urban roads. It features an ultra-compact design with cutting-edge speeds of 4.8m/s, and climbing grade of 30°. Thanks to its modular design and standard CAN interface, users can easily install and expand various autonomous system components to accomplish autonomous driving and commercial robot applications such as parcel delivery, unmanned logistics, unmanned meal delivery, scenic spot, and patrolling.

    The HUNTER-SE’s modular shock absorption system includes a swing arm at the front wheel and independent suspension at the back wheel, enabling effortless traversal over challenging terrain. With the onboard battery management system and the quick release battery replacement design, the HUNTER-SE can operate long enough to accomplish any tasks you may throw at it.

    Upgraded Power System for High-speed Driving

    Inheriting the simplified design and steel body of the HUNTER series, the HUNTER-SE utilizes an upgraded power system and the in-wheel hub motor technology can provide a high driving speed of up to 4.8m/s. Taking advantage of front steering similar to motor vehicles, the HUNTER-SE can precisely control motion while minimizing the wear and tear of the tire, making it suitable for challenging indoor and outdoor operations.

    ROS - Robot Operating System (ROS or ros) is an open-source robotics middleware suite. Although ROS is not an operating system but a collection of software frameworks for robot software development, it provides services designed for a heterogeneous computer cluster such as hardware abstraction, low-level device control, implementation of commonly used functionality, message-passing between processes, and package management.

    CAN - A Controller Area Network (CAN bus) is a robust vehicle bus standard designed to allow microcontrollers and devices to communicate with each other's applications without a host computer. It is a message-based protocol, designed originally for multiplex electrical wiring within automobiles to save on copper, but it can also be used in many other contexts. SCOUT has an internal controller that runs on a CAN-based communication protocol. Users can communicate with the controller over CAN through AgileX’s open CAN bus protocol.

    IP Upgrade - An optional upgrade to HUNTER’s IP rating from the standard 22 to the significantly upgraded 54, protecting it from splashes of water in every direction.

    Rails - The top of the robot provides a standardized mounting solution with aluminum T-slot rails, convenient for securely mounting external equipment and sensors or one of the available preconfigured R&D or navigation kits.


    Extremely tough axles & drive system - Both of HUNTER’s front wheels are driven independently by 200w brushless servo motors & have rocker suspensions with shock absorbers, giving it the ability to handle rough terrain while ensuring power and stability. As a result, it can easily take on up to 5cm tall obstacles.

    Battery Upgrade (Optional) - (60Ah Expansion Battery) By default, the Hunter 2.0 UGV comes with a 24v30Ah battery which allows for a maximum travel distance (without load) of 22km. With the optional 60Ah upgrade the maximum travel distance increases to 40km.

    AutoKit (Optional)- The AgileX AutoKit is a full-stack and cost-effective autonomous driving development & education kit based on Autoware open-source software. It provides a powerful autonomous driving sensor system that seamlessly integrates into your robot platform. With this software & hardware platform stack, along with comprehensive user guides, the AutoKit empowers educational experts and industry developers to quickly and easily deploy autonomous robots and develop autonomous driving research in various industries. The AutoWare Kit comes with the following sensors, devices, & computers: A computer with 8 cores and 32GB of RAM, Robotsense RO-LiDAR-16 16 channel LiDAR, LCD display, & a USB-to-CAN module.
